Understanding Leak Detection Techniques
Pinpointing leaks can be a challenging task, but with the right skills, you can become a leak detection expert. A comprehensive approach involves grasping the various types of leaks and their roots.
Start by getting to know yourself with common plumbing issues, such as leaky faucets, trickling pipes, and faulty appliances. Once you have a solid foundation of these problems, you can move on to examining the indicators of a leak.
These signs may include elevated water bills, musty odors, apparent water stains, and changes in ground moisture.
Leveraging the appropriate tools is crucial for effective leak detection.
A basic set of tools may include a flashlight, a plunger, a wrench, and a screwdriver. For more sophisticated leaks, you may need to consider specialized equipment such as a leak detector.
Remember that safety should always be your top priority. Always turn off the water supply before undertaking any repairs, and utilize protective gear such as gloves and eye goggles.
Curbing Water Loss with Cutting-Edge Leak Detection Techniques
In an era marked by growing water scarcity and the imperative to conserve this precious resource, identifying and mitigating leaks has become paramount. Traditional leak detection methods often prove inefficient and time-consuming. Thankfully, advanced/state-of-the-art/sophisticated technologies are revolutionizing leak detection, enabling us to pinpoint even the tiniest/smallest/most subtle of water losses with unprecedented accuracy. These cutting-edge/innovative/groundbreaking strategies not only reduce water waste but also minimize damage to property and protect our environment.
- Sound-based leak detection employs sensors that pick up the characteristic/unique/subtle sounds produced by escaping water, allowing technicians to pinpoint leaks with remarkable precision.
- Thermal imaging technology detects heat variations caused by water leakage, revealing hidden problems in pipes and fittings even through walls and insulation.
- Water monitoring systems continuously monitor water usage patterns and detect/flag/identify anomalies that may indicate a leak, providing real-time alerts for prompt action.
By embracing these advanced/innovative/futuristic leak detection strategies, we can significantly reduce water waste, conserve this vital resource, and contribute to a more sustainable future.

Smart Leak Detection: Sensors and Technology
Modern water leak detection has evolved dramatically with the integration of smart sensors and cutting-edge technology. These sophisticated devices utilize a range of techniques to pinpoint leaks in real time, minimizing damage and reducing valuable resources.
From ultrasonic sensors that pick up on high-frequency sounds of escaping water to pressure sensors that track changes in volume, smart leak detection systems offer a multifaceted approach to safeguarding property and infrastructure.
- IoT sensors allow for remote tracking of water usage and potential leaks, enabling prompt action even when users are away from the premises.
- Machine learning play a crucial role in interpreting sensor data, identifying patterns and anomalies that may indicate a leak. This sophisticated approach allows for reliable leak detection and reduction of costly water damage.
Additionally, smart leak detection systems often integrate with building management platforms, enabling control of water distribution. This integrated approach not only helps conserve water but also enhances overall energy consumption.
